What You'll Do
We are seeking experienced Senior Appian Developer Consultants to support our delivery teams and advise our clients. These consultants play a crucial role in scaling our business by guiding solution delivery and integrating cutting-edge Appian solutions into client architectures.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ead implementation teams through complex technical solutions using Appian and related technologies
- Support design, development, and testing activities
- Guide clients on architecture design, configuration management, DevSecOps, and other program initiatives
- Ensure solutions are scalable and performant
- Create and document implementation best practices and knowledge base articles for internal enablement
- Provide thought leadership on process improvement
- Mentor and train internal resources
Required Qualifications
- 3+ years of experience with Appian solutions
- 5+ years of related IT experience
- Bachelor’s Degree (or equivalent) in Computer Science, Information Systems, Systems Engineering, or related field
- Active Appian Senior or Lead Certification
- Strong experience with Appian delivery using Agile methodologies
- Strong technical design and implementation skills
- Effective communication and problem-solving abilities
- Strong organizational and attention to detail skills
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and prioritize tasks
- Willingness to travel (0-15%) for client meetings as needed
- Experience working with the following technologies: Appian, RDBMS (e.g., Oracle, SQL Server, MySQL/MariaDB), Web services, integrations and middleware (e.g., RESTful/SOAP, Mule/IIB/Fusion)
- Experience with the following areas is a plus: Cloud Computing/IaaS (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), Authentication (e.g., SAML, Kerberos, OAuth, LDAP), Data management and data visualization/BI, DevSecOps and/or Configuration Management, Machine Learning, Artificial Intelligence
- US Citizenship required
